US President Donald Trump has approved a major civil nuclear cooperation agreement with Saudi Arabia. This move could reshape energy ties between the two countries while also triggering concerns over nuclear weapons proliferation in the Middle East.
The proposed agreement, expected to remain in force for 30 years and valued at tens of billions of dollars, will allow American companies to play the leading role in building Saudi Arabia’s civilian nuclear programme. At the same time, the deal could pave the way for the kingdom to enrich uranium on its own soil under certain conditions, marking a significant shift in US policy toward nuclear cooperation in the region.
The Trump administration is expected to send the agreement to the US Congress in the coming days for review.
A 30-year nuclear partnership
At the heart of the package is a “123 Agreement,” the legal framework that governs US nuclear cooperation with other countries. Such agreements are required under the US Atomic Energy Act before American companies can transfer nuclear technology or equipment abroad.
Under the proposed arrangement, US firms will build nuclear power reactors and supply other civilian nuclear technologies to Saudi Arabia. The deal is also designed to give American companies a dominant position in the Saudi nuclear market while limiting opportunities for competing suppliers from countries such as Russia and China.
Administration officials argue that this approach will strengthen US-Saudi relations, support America’s nuclear industry and keep Washington closely involved in Saudi Arabia’s nuclear programme rather than allowing rival powers to fill that role.
Uranium enrichment provision draws attention
One of the most closely watched parts of the agreement is its approach to uranium enrichment.
Unlike many countries that import enriched uranium for use in civilian nuclear reactors, Saudi Arabia could eventually be allowed to enrich uranium within its own territory.
According to the agreement, American and Saudi officials will first conduct a joint two-year study to determine whether domestic uranium enrichment is commercially practical and necessary for the kingdom’s civilian nuclear programme.
If the study concludes that local enrichment is justified, the United States would build the enrichment facility in Saudi Arabia. The plant would reportedly operate under a “black box” arrangement, meaning sensitive enrichment technology would remain under American control and would not be transferred to Saudi authorities.
Trump administration officials say this model would allow Saudi Arabia to produce fuel for civilian reactors while preventing the misuse of enrichment technology for military purposes.
The agreement also states that if Washington decides not to proceed with uranium enrichment after the study, Saudi Arabia would not be allowed to build an enrichment facility independently or with another foreign partner for the next 10 years.
Missing safeguards raise concerns
Despite these assurances, the agreement has attracted criticism because it leaves out several safeguards that have traditionally been part of US nuclear cooperation agreements.
Most notably, Saudi Arabia has not accepted the so-called “Gold Standard.” This provision, included in the US nuclear agreement with the United Arab Emirates, requires a country to permanently give up uranium enrichment and the reprocessing of spent nuclear fuel.
The Saudi agreement does not include that commitment.
It also does not require Saudi Arabia to adopt the International Atomic Energy Agency’s (IAEA) Additional Protocol. The Additional Protocol gives the UN nuclear watchdog wider inspection powers, including the ability to conduct inspections at undeclared nuclear sites if concerns arise.
Instead of following this internationally recognised inspection system, the United States and Saudi Arabia are expected to establish their own bilateral safeguards for monitoring nuclear activities linked to the agreement.
But many Middle East experts have alleged that these arrangements may not provide the same level of transparency as the IAEA’s enhanced inspection regime.
Why uranium enrichment matters
The debate over the agreement centres on uranium enrichment because it has both civilian and military uses.
Low-enriched uranium is commonly used as fuel in nuclear power plants to generate electricity. However, if uranium is enriched to much higher levels, it can become the key material required for nuclear weapons.
Another pathway to building a nuclear weapon involves reprocessing spent nuclear fuel to separate plutonium. For this reason, uranium enrichment and plutonium reprocessing are considered the two main routes to producing fissile material for nuclear weapons.
Most countries operating civilian nuclear reactors import enriched uranium under strict international oversight instead of producing it themselves. Allowing a country to enrich uranium domestically without internationally accepted safeguards is often viewed as increasing the risk of nuclear weapons proliferation.
Saudi Arabia says programme is for peaceful purposes
Saudi Arabia has consistently maintained that its nuclear programme is intended only to meet the country’s growing energy needs.
The kingdom hopes to use nuclear power to generate electricity, allowing it to consume less oil at home and export more crude oil to international markets. Saudi officials also believe the programme could help develop the country’s uranium resources and diversify its energy mix.
However, concerns remain because Saudi Crown Prince Mohammed bin Salman said in 2018 that if regional rival Iran were to obtain a nuclear weapon, Saudi Arabia would pursue one as well.
That earlier statement continues to shape international concerns over any proposal that gives Riyadh greater access to sensitive nuclear technologies.
Trump administration defends the agreement
The Trump administration argues that keeping American companies deeply involved in Saudi Arabia’s nuclear programme is the safest approach.
Officials say US participation would ensure that enriched uranium is used only for civilian purposes and that spent nuclear fuel cannot be diverted for weapons production.
Energy Secretary Chris Wright, who discussed the agreement with Saudi Energy Minister Prince Abdulaziz bin Salman during a visit to the kingdom in April 2025, is expected to sign the agreement alongside his Saudi counterpart formally.
In a statement, Wright said the agreements maintain the highest standards of nuclear safety and non-proliferation while using advanced American nuclear technology.
Supporters also argue that the deal could revive the US nuclear industry, create business opportunities for companies such as Westinghouse Electric, and prevent Russia or China from becoming Saudi Arabia’s primary nuclear partners.
Westinghouse’s AP1000 reactor, capable of producing around 1,100 megawatts of electricity, is expected to be among the leading technologies offered under the agreement.
Critics warn of wider regional impact
Many nuclear experts and lawmakers remain unconvinced. They argue that allowing Saudi Arabia to develop uranium enrichment capability even under American supervision could encourage other countries in the Middle East, including Turkey, Egypt and the United Arab Emirates, to seek similar rights.
Some analysts believe this could trigger a regional competition in nuclear technology, increasing long-term security risks.
Others point out that the agreement comes as Washington continues to pressure Iran to limit its nuclear programme and give up its stockpile of highly enriched uranium. Critics say helping Saudi Arabia expand its civilian nuclear capabilities while demanding strict limits on Iran creates a difficult diplomatic balance.
The Trump administration rejects that argument, saying the Saudi programme will remain peaceful because of US oversight and agreed safeguards.
Israel no longer linked to the agreement
The agreement also marks a departure from the approach taken by the previous Biden administration.
The Biden administration had been willing to pursue civil nuclear cooperation with Saudi Arabia but linked the proposal to Riyadh establishing diplomatic relations with Israel as part of a broader regional agreement.
Those efforts stalled following Hamas’ October 2023 attack on Israel and the subsequent war in Gaza.
The Trump administration has continued to encourage Saudi Arabia to join the Abraham Accords but has not made normalisation with Israel a condition for the nuclear agreement.
Congressional review ahead
The agreement will now be submitted to the US Congress, where lawmakers will have an opportunity to review it.
Although some members of Congress are expected to challenge the proposal because of its approach to uranium enrichment and nuclear safeguards, blocking the agreement would be difficult. Under US law, opponents would need enough votes to pass a joint resolution and, if necessary, override a presidential veto with a two-thirds majority.
As debate begins in Washington, the agreement is likely to become one of the most closely watched international nuclear deals in recent years, with supporters highlighting its strategic and economic benefits, while critics warn that relaxing long-standing safeguards could increase the risk of nuclear weapons proliferation in an already volatile region.
